Axelrod: Electoral College revolt would be "very, very destructive" http://hill.cm/8VXcxR5

Democratic strategist David Axelrod on Monday warned against an Electoral College revolt against President-elect Donald Trump.

"Look, Alexander Hamilton conceived of the Electoral College and the founding fathers as a buffer against democracy run amok, as a safe guard against someone who was unsuited for the office to take the office," Axelrod said on CNN's "New Day."

"But it's never been used in the history of our Republic," he continued.

“To have it happen now, despite the fact that Hillary Clinton won the popular vote and all that's swirling around with Russia and so on," he said, "I believe would split the country apart in a really destructive way and it would set this mad cycle in which every election the Electoral College vote would be in question.”
